How Wagering Works
\n
Wagering requirements determine how much you must bet before bonus funds become withdrawable. Assume you claim a $100 bonus with a 35x wagering requirement on the bonus amount only. The calculation is straightforward:
\n
Important: The formula is: (Bonus Amount) × (Wagering Requirement) = Total Wagering Needed.
\n
For a $100 bonus with 35x wagering: 100 × 35 = $3,500. You must place bets worth $3,500 before withdrawing any winnings from the bonus.
\n
Game contributions vary. Slots typically contribute 100%, while table games may contribute only 10% or less. If you play blackjack ($10 per hand, 10% contribution), only $1 of each $10 bet counts toward the wagering goal. To clear the $3,500 requirement with blackjack, you would need to bet $35,000 in total ($3,500 / 0.10).
\n
To illustrate with expected loss: Suppose you play a slot with a 96% RTP. The house edge is 4%. While wagering $3,500, your expected loss is $3,500 × 4% = $140. Compare this to the bonus value: you deposited $100 (your own money) and got $100 bonus. After wagering, you might retain some of the bonus if you win, but the expected loss often exceeds the bonus amount. Use a bonus calculator to estimate your real expected return.

Is It Safe?
\n
Online casinos operating under a Curacao eGaming license must adhere to basic player protection standards. However, Curacao regulations are less strict than those of Malta or the UK. Note: Winnings from Curacao-licensed casinos may be subject to local income tax in your jurisdiction — consult a tax advisor.
\n
The site uses 128-bit SSL encryption to protect data transfers. Random Number Generators (RNGs) are tested by independent agencies for fairness, though results are not always publicly available. Player funds should be kept in segregated accounts, but this is not guaranteed under Curacao law. For extra security, enable two-factor authentication (2FA) after registration.

Pro Tips
\n
Responsible gambling tools help you stay in control. Use these settings from day one:
\n
- \n
- Deposit limits: Set a weekly cap to avoid chasing losses.
- Session limits: Use the ‘reality check’ feature to receive reminders of how long you have been playing.
- Loss limits: Some operators allow you to cap net losses over a period.
- Self-exclusion: If you need a break, enforce a temporary ban of at least 30 days. This can be extended later.
\n
\n
\n
\n
\n
Always review your play history weekly. If you notice an upward trend in time or money spent, tighten your limits immediately.
